I prefer to use H&R Block. If you go through military one source, it's free and includes up to 3 state returns, not just federal like other free programs. I've also tried TurboTax, TaxACT, and Tax Slayer, and I think the interface and setup of H&R Block is the most user friendly.

Just did taxes in both turbo tax and free H&R Block online from Mil onesource.. was having a discrepancy in my federal refund between the two. I am Civ employed + Guard. On my form 2606, turbotax takes the exact amount of deductions and puts it in 1040 line 24. H&R block, with the same values on form 2606, puts in a value 10% less on form 1040 line 24.

Still investigating, but I have no idea wtf HR block is coming up with that number. With Turbo tax, i've traced all the calculations and they are legit.

edit - the form 2606 is for non-reimbursed job related expenses. i.e., for being in the guard, travel costs related to commuting > 100 miles to perform duty. Includes airfare, lodging, parking, meals (@ 50%), etc.
